Although mesquite isn’t the best for smokers, it will give meats a deep taste that compliments other woods. It burns very hot and isn't good for low-and-slow smoking. Instead, mesquite is best suited for high-heat grilling. Because it is a prolific producer of smoke and sparks, mesquite makes a great choice when you want to cook fast.
